提升微信小程序体验:加载与交互设计全攻略

本文深入探讨微信小程序体验优化,聚焦加载与交互设计,为开发者提供实用策略和方法。

技术专业区 发布时间:2026-01-20 来原: 巨数科技 23 阅读 0 点赞


一、微信小程序加载优化的重要性
在当今快节奏的时代,用户对小程序的加载速度有着极高的期望。加载缓慢的小程序不仅会让用户失去耐心,还可能导致用户流失。据相关研究表明,小程序加载时间每延长 1 秒,用户跳出率就会显著增加。因此,优化微信小程序的加载速度是提升用户体验的首要任务。

二、加载优化的策略
1. 代码压缩与优化
小程序的代码体积直接影响加载速度。开发者应尽量压缩代码,去除不必要的注释、空格和冗余代码。微信官方提供了代码压缩工具,可以帮助开发者自动完成这一过程。同时,合理拆分代码,采用分包加载的方式,将不常用的代码和资源放在分包中,在需要时再进行加载,能够有效减少初始加载时间。官方文档可参考:https://developers.weixin.qq.com/miniprogram/dev/framework/subpackages/basic.html 。
2. 图片优化
图片是小程序中占用空间较大的资源,对图片进行优化非常重要。可以选择合适的图片格式,如 WebP 格式,它在保证图片质量的前提下,能显著减小文件大小。此外,还可以对图片进行裁剪和压缩,避免使用过大尺寸的图片。
3. 缓存策略
合理利用缓存机制可以减少不必要的网络请求,提高加载速度。对于一些不经常变化的数据和资源,可以将其缓存到本地,下次加载时直接从本地读取。微信小程序提供了 wx.setStorage 和 wx.getStorage 等 API 来实现缓存功能。

三、微信小程序交互设计的原则
1. 简洁易用
交互设计应遵循简洁原则,避免过多复杂的操作和界面元素。用户能够轻松找到所需功能,操作流程应简单明了。例如,减少用户的点击次数,采用一键式操作等。
2. 反馈及时
当用户进行操作时,应及时给予反馈,让用户知道操作是否成功。可以通过动画效果、提示信息等方式来实现。比如,点击按钮后,按钮有短暂的变色或动画效果,提示用户操作已被接收。
3. 一致性
交互设计应保持一致性,包括界面风格、操作方式等。这样可以降低用户的学习成本,使用户更容易上手。例如,在整个小程序中,按钮的样式和功能应保持一致。

四、交互设计的优化方法
1. 手势操作设计
充分利用微信小程序支持的手势操作,如滑动、长按等,为用户提供更加便捷的交互体验。例如,在图片浏览界面,用户可以通过左右滑动切换图片。
2. 导航设计
合理的导航设计能够帮助用户快速找到所需内容。可以采用底部导航栏、侧边栏等方式,让用户清晰地了解小程序的结构和功能。同时,导航栏的图标和文字应简洁明了,易于识别。
3. 情感化设计
在交互设计中融入情感元素,能够增强用户与小程序之间的情感共鸣。例如,使用可爱的动画形象、温馨的提示语等,让用户在使用小程序时感受到愉悦和舒适。

通过对微信小程序加载与交互设计的优化,可以显著提升小程序的用户体验,吸引更多用户,提高用户的忠诚度。开发者应不断关注用户需求和体验,持续优化小程序的性能和设计。 提升微信小程序体验:加载与交互设计全攻略
点赞(0) 打赏